Professional Copywriting
Effective search engine optimization and online marketing relies upon well-written content that incorporates keywords relevant to your website. Good search engine optimized content will not only help to increase traffic to your website, but it will also showcase your business, goods, and services in a well-developed and informative manner.
Website copywriting requires unique structure and style that is different than copywriting for printed materials, such as brochures, books, postcards, and marketing kits. Not only should you incorporate your keywords, but there are also best practice strategies for where those keywords should be incorporated within your content.
Here are a few things you need to know about website copywriting:
Select the best possible keywords for your website
When it comes to using keywords in your website content, it’s important that you select the right keywords for your business out of the milieu of frequently searched terms that are available. Not only should you focus on your first-priority keywords when you develop your copy, but you may want to consider using synonyms as well.
In order to select the most appropriate keywords for your site it’s important to take a look at which terms your potential customers are actually searching for when they look for information online. Using search engine keyword search analytical tools can help to create a list of the best possible keywords from which you can choose.
It’s not which keywords you use; it’s how you use them
It’s not enough to simply feather your chosen keywords throughout your website content; you should place your keywords purposefully throughout each page of your website. There are very specific search engine optimization strategies for copywriting that rely upon keyword placement on a webpage.
For example, it’s important to use the right keywords for your search engine optimization goals when writing headlines. Where you place your keywords within each paragraph of a webpage also makes a significant difference on the impact that your copy makes on your search engine rankings.
It’s also important to be sure that you use your keywords in ways that are considered appropriate by search engines. By using keywords too frequently throughout a webpage or by placing them on a webpage improperly, your website could be blacklisted from search engines, which would significantly hurt a website’s search engine ranking. Be sure that your keywords help your website search engine optimization—not hurt it.
